Hennadiy Chemеris

The premiere of Avatar: Fire and Ash is expected this December, but as director James Cameron recently revealed, some people have already had the chance to see the film. According to him, the initial reactions have been positive.

The director stated that Avatar: Fire and Ash is currently in the final stages of post-production and has even been shown to a select few in a closed screening.

I've shown it to a few selected people and the feedback has been it's definitely the most emotional and maybe the best of the three so far. We'll find out, you know, but I feel pretty good about it. And the work is exceptional from the actors. It's pretty heart-wrenching in a good way.
— James Cameron

Preliminary reports suggest the budget for the third installment is $250 million. As a reminder, the previous two films have both made it onto the list of the highest-grossing movies in history: the 2009 Avatar grossed $2.9 billion, while Avatar: The Way of Water brought in $2.3 billion.
